This file contains the Header and Main body of letters that are generated by the IB package. Sites should edit the header of the letter to their own address. Sites may edit the main body of the letter to change the signer of the letter or add in contact persons and phone numbers. The text of the letters have been approved by MCCR VACO. Per VHA Directive 10-93-142, this file definition should not be modified.

DESCRIPTION: This is the line number that the patient address should start on. The default if this is unanswered is line 15.
To account for slight differences in printers and automated letter folders the line that the address starts on is now a parameter. Set this to the correct value for the printer and folder combination for your facility.
This field contains the main body of the letter that will be printed after the salutation and includes the signature line.
TECHNICAL DESCR:
The data in this field will be printed as it is entered. VA FileMan utilities are not used to format the data, hence, any imbedded functions will not print properly.
The first six lines in this field will be centered at the top of plain paper to form the header of the letter. The data in this field should be edited to the correct station name and address of your facility.
